Increasing usb output volume?
I'm using cakewalk or reaper for recording using the USB outputs. Is there a way to increase the output volume of the usb output? It ends up tracking way too low in cakewalk or reaper.

Re: Increasing usb output volume?
You mean for the rig to reaper? When you hold the edit menu on the 11r for 2 sec. there are several option available; one of them is rig balancing; you can adjust the overall volume for every preset in that menu.
